Position: Print Quality Specialist

Company Overview:

SYNCHONISE RESOURCING SOLUTIONS is a leading provider of staffing and recruitment solutions in Melbourne, VIC. We specialize in connecting highly skilled professionals with top companies in various industries.

Position Overview:

We are currently seeking a Print Quality Specialist to join our team on a contractor basis. The Print Quality Specialist will be responsible for ensuring the quality of all printed materials produced by our client's company. This role requires a detail-oriented individual with strong communication skills and a keen eye for detail.

Key Responsibilities:

- Develop and implement quality control processes for all print materials

- Conduct regular quality checks on printed materials to ensure they meet company standards

- Identify and resolve any quality issues that arise during the printing process

- Collaborate with designers and printers to ensure all materials are produced accurately and to the highest quality

- Train and educate team members on quality standards and processes

- Monitor and analyze data to identify trends and areas for improvement in the printing process

- Communicate with clients to understand their quality requirements and provide solutions to meet their needs

- Stay up-to-date with industry trends and advancements in printing technology to continuously improve quality standards

Qualifications:

- Bachelor's degree in Printing Technology, Graphic Design, or a related field

- Minimum of 3 years of experience in print quality management

- Strong knowledge of printing processes, materials, and equipment

- Excellent attention to detail and ability to identify and resolve quality issues

- Proficient in Microsoft Office and Adobe Creative Suite

- Strong communication and interpersonal skills

- Ability to work independently and in a team environment

- Prior experience in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ment is preferred

Contract Details:

This is a contractor position based in Melbourne, VIC. The contract duration will be determined based on the project requirements.
